Introduction to Brazil Nut Irrigation

Brazil nuts are unique nut crops harvested primarily from wild trees in the Amazon rainforest, with some cultivation efforts in suitable tropical regions. These massive trees are among the tallest in the Amazon, producing large pods containing valuable nuts. In cultivation settings, consistent moisture is essential for optimal development and yield. Solar water pumps provide Brazil nut growers with sustainable irrigation solutions.

Brazil Nut Tree Water Requirements

Brazil nut trees are native to tropical rainforest environments with high rainfall, but in cultivation settings they require supplemental irrigation during dry periods. Mature trees consume significant water due to their massive size, while young trees need consistent moisture for establishment. Critical periods include flowering, pod development, and the long maturation period when water stress reduces pod fill and nut quality.

Solar Pump System Design for Brazil Nuts

Brazil nut orchards in cultivation settings use drip irrigation or micro-sprinklers positioned to deliver water to the extensive root zone of these large trees. Solar pumps of 10 to 30 kilowatts draw from wells, reservoirs, or surface water and distribute through pressure-compensating systems. The massive size of Brazil nut trees requires extensive irrigation coverage. Storage tanks provide capacity for cloudy days.

Impact on Pod Development and Nut Quality

Water management affects Brazil nut characteristics that determine market value. Water stress during pod development reduces pod size and nut fill. Consistent irrigation maintains the large pod size and high nut quality that markets demand. Proper water management also supports the complex pollination system involving orchid bees that Brazil nuts depend on.

Tree Establishment and Long-Term Growth

Brazil nut trees require many years to reach maturity and produce commercially. During establishment and early growth, consistent moisture is essential for development. Solar irrigation during this period supports long-term orchard establishment and eventual commercial production.
